public static enum SUTime.StandardTemporalType extends java.lang.Enum<SUTime.StandardTemporalType>
Enum Constant and Description |
---|
DAY_OF_WEEK |
DAY_OF_YEAR |
DAYS_OF_WEEK |
HALF_OF_YEAR |
MONTH_OF_YEAR |
PART_OF_YEAR |
QUARTER_OF_YEAR |
REFDATE |
REFTIME |
SEASON_OF_YEAR |
TIME_OF_DAY |
WEEK_OF_YEAR |
Modifier and Type | Method and Description |
---|---|
protected SUTime.Temporal |
_createTemporal(int n) |
static SUTime.Temporal |
create(Expressions.CompositeValue compositeValue) |
SUTime.Temporal |
createTemporal(int n) |
SUTime.Duration |
getDuration() |
SUTime.Duration |
getGranularity() |
SUTime.Duration |
getPeriod() |
SUTime.TimexType |
getTimexType() |
static SUTime.StandardTemporalType |
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.
|
static SUTime.StandardTemporalType[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final SUTime.StandardTemporalType REFDATE
public static final SUTime.StandardTemporalType REFTIME
public static final SUTime.StandardTemporalType TIME_OF_DAY
public static final SUTime.StandardTemporalType DAY_OF_YEAR
public static final SUTime.StandardTemporalType DAY_OF_WEEK
public static final SUTime.StandardTemporalType DAYS_OF_WEEK
public static final SUTime.StandardTemporalType WEEK_OF_YEAR
public static final SUTime.StandardTemporalType MONTH_OF_YEAR
public static final SUTime.StandardTemporalType PART_OF_YEAR
public static final SUTime.StandardTemporalType SEASON_OF_YEAR
public static final SUTime.StandardTemporalType QUARTER_OF_YEAR
public static final SUTime.StandardTemporalType HALF_OF_YEAR
public static SUTime.StandardTemporalType[] values()
for (SUTime.StandardTemporalType c : SUTime.StandardTemporalType.values()) System.out.println(c);
public static SUTime.StandardTemporalType valueOf(java.lang.String name)
name
- the name of the enum constant to be returned.java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is nullpublic SUTime.TimexType getTimexType()
public SUTime.Duration getDuration()
public SUTime.Duration getPeriod()
public SUTime.Duration getGranularity()
protected SUTime.Temporal _createTemporal(int n)
public SUTime.Temporal createTemporal(int n)
public static SUTime.Temporal create(Expressions.CompositeValue compositeValue)